Output e54c89163036ad136e4a5397246184aaf5ac3409a2ca76cd2e6d7bba37d2139f:0

value
11507000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e4581ec072f4ff95ba1aa3ccb20680a93230d9 OP_EQUAL
address
39FJsudvT771GtsKFpCa7kwzgz3oMrpHdD
transaction
e54c89163036ad136e4a5397246184aaf5ac3409a2ca76cd2e6d7bba37d2139f
spent
true